Collect all essential details before contacting your work legal representative. That includes pay stubs, copies of contracts, performance evaluations from previous settings, and any info pertaining to the dispute. Having all appropriate papers prepared before assessment with your lawyer can make the process much more reliable and thorough. For Unjust Dismissal, the focus is on the reason and procedure of termination, as an example being rejected for inequitable factors, without a legitimate factor e.g redundancy or otherwise complying with a proper corrective or complaint treatment. For Wrongful Dismissal, nevertheless, the focus gets on the legal legal rights of the employee.
